India: Record spike of 52,123 COVID-19 cases in 24 hours

COVID-19 cases in India crossed the 50,000 mark in a single day for the first time, pushing the virus tally to 1,583,792, while the recoveries went past 1 million on Thursday, according to the Union Health Ministry data.
The country registered a record increase of 52,123 infections in a span of 24-hours, while the death-toll climbed to 34,968 with 775 people succumbing to the disease in a day, the data updated at 8am showed.
